Prep stars of the night for Friday, April 12:
Aiden Van Rensum, Archbishop Murphy baseball
Van Rensum, a sophomore, threw three innings of scoreless relief and went 2-for-4 at the plate with a double and an RBI as the Wildcats beat Mountlake Terrace 4-0.
Jacob Burkett, Arlington baseball
Burkett, a sophomore, tossed a three-hit shutout as the Eagles beat Stanwood 10-0 in the first game of a doubleheader.
Dylan Schwartzmiller, Snohomish baseball
Schwartzmiller, a freshman, drove in the game-winning run to cap a four-run seventh inning as the Panthers beat Oak Harbor 7-6 to sweep a doubleheader.
Nicole Jocobi, Granite Falls softball
Jocobi, a junior, went 3-for-3 with a double, a triple, two RBI and scored three runs as the Tigers pounded Sultan 21-2.
Christian Engmann, King’s boys soccer
Engmann, a junior, scored two goals in the Knights’ 5-0 shutout of Coupeville.
